Out of …moreJohn Harmon’s father saw preschool aged Bella throwing a temper tantrum and beating her father with her bonnet. He stopped and asked her name. Out of spite for his son, required that to have his inheritance his son must marry that spoiled girl whom he assumed would make his sons life a living hell. (less)
Joe It was written and released in 19 monthly installments from 1864-1865.
